The Impact You'll Make:

Train Bottler Sales Representatives on product knowledge, sales methodologies, and marketing and sales promotions by influencing bottler actions at multiple levels of their organization. Accomplish through partnership ride-alongs in retail outlets, sales presentations within the bottler's facilities, 'huddle' calls with bottler reps, and team calls with both internal and external partners.

Sell at retail (outlet level) aligned against quarterly strategic initiatives focused on innovation, distribution, displays, and cold/ambient equipment placements. Accomplish in conjunction with bottler partners in the trade together or through influencing bottler actions.

Complete comprehension and utilization of all Monster Energy Company tools (CRM) and capabilities to maximize productivity and results in their assigned market including but not limited to surveys, training tools, sales data software, asset allocation, and internal social platforms.

Participate in business unit crew drives, market audits, company meetings and events, sampling initiatives, and local retail meetings. Duties would include set-up, tear-down, customer hosting, sales presentations and additional responsibilities.

Who You Are:

Prefer a bachelor's degree in the field of -- Business Administration or related field of study

Experience Desired: Minimum 1 year of experience in Sales or Marketing

Additional Experience Desired: Minimum 1 year of experience in Beverage or Consumer packaged goods (CPG) field

Computer Skills Desired: Computer operating skills in and outside of an office environment to include handheld devices

Preferred Certifications: Maintain an acceptable driving record in order to be covered by the company’s insurance carrier


Monster Energy provides competitive total compensation. The estimated annual salary range for this position is listed below. Actual compensation may vary based on skills, qualifications, experience, and work location.

Pay Range
$45,750—$61,000 USD
